Four Highland takeaways have closed after being cited by environmental health officers. Sweet&Spicy in Alness, Bengal Spice in High Street and Shelina Spice in Provost Sinclair Road all faced closure last month. A senior environmental health officer at the Highland Council said: "We have taken the decision to shut these premises down as a result of their failing to meet food safety standards."
